Warning Signs You Need Restaurant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your restaurant,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it quickly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your restaurant’s fl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s crucial to address the issue before it becomes a more significant problem.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ks can show a more significant issue.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to assess and repair the damage before it’s too late.

Unexplained Temperature Fluctuations

Unusual temperature fluctuations can show a problem with your restaurant’s HVAC system or water damage. If you notice any unusual temperature changes, it’s essential to investigate the cause.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can show a problem with your restaurant’s equipment or insulation. If you notice a sudden spike in your energy bills, it’s essential to investigate the cause.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ew can show a serious problem.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under a sink Yes No You can fix it yourself with a DIY repair kit.
Large flood with standing water No Yes It’s too much water for you to handle safely and efficiently.
Water damage to walls and ceilings No Yes You need specialized equipment and expertise to dry and restore the affected areas.
Musty odors and mold growth No Yes You need professional equipment and expertise to remove the mold and prevent further growth.
Water damage to electrical equipment No Yes You need specialized equipment and expertise to safely restore the affected equipment.
Visible water stains and leaks No Yes You need professional equipment and expertise to locate and repair the source of the leak.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ost in Lancaster, TX

The cost of Restaurant Water Damage Restoration services in Lancaster, TX can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, equipment used
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, equipment used
Equipment Restoration $1,500 – $10,000 Severity of damage, type of equipment
Final Inspection and Clean-up $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ment used

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Our team offers free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an to fit your budget and needs.
